Dreadlocks, often referred to as "locs," have a rich cultural and historical significance that transcends mere fashion. The hairstyle is deeply rooted in African traditions and the Rastafarian movement, symbolizing a spiritual journey and a connection to one's heritage. The origins of dreadlocks can be traced back to ancient civilizations, including the Maasai warriors of Kenya and the spiritual leaders of ancient Egypt.

During his formative years, Combs was influenced by the burgeoning hip-hop scene in New York City. The music of artists like Grandmaster Flash and the Furious Five, Run-D.M.C., and LL Cool J resonated with him, sparking his passion for music. His entrepreneurial instincts were also evident from a young age, as he organized dance parties and events in his neighborhood, showcasing his natural talent for business and entertainment.
